Het probleem van de tegelzetter

Hallo allemaal.

Nieuw in het gebruik van slw, word ik geconfronteerd met het probleem van de "tegelzetter". Ik heb een oppervlak dat ik graag wil bedekken met een patroon of tegel van één maat. Ik heb een tegel gemaakt en vervolgens bedek ik met de herhaalfunctie het oppervlak totdat het overloopt. Toen ik een kamerlijst maakte, bedacht ik dat door een andere naam te geven aan elke tegel die uit het oppervlak steekt, ik het oppervlak van elke randtegel kon aanpassen zodat het past bij de rand van het te bedekken oppervlak; Maar als ik een wijziging aanbreng in een tegel, zelfs als deze niet dezelfde naam heeft als de andere tegels, heeft de wijziging gevolgen voor alle tegels. Dus mijn oplossing is niet goed en ik zie niet hoe ik dit probleem van de "tegelzetter" kan oplossen!

Heeft iemand een idee van manipulatie die dit probleem zou oplossen. Bedankt voor je hulp en ideeën

Met vriendelijke groet

Meester 

Hallo

Kunt u een zeefdruk van uw bestand plaatsen zodat we het beter kunnen zien. Heeft u configuraties van uw kamer? Normaal gesproken zou je in je herhaling de configuratie moeten kunnen wijzigen en dus zou het geen invloed moeten hebben op de anderen als je deze wijzigt.

3 likes

In dit bijgevoegde bestand heb ik mijn terras getekend en heb ik verschillende kleuren toegepast op mijn configuraties.


terrasse.pptx
1 like

Hallo, wees voorzichtig, een andere naam betekent niet dat de bestanden anders zijn, je moet de externe link onderscheiden van de tegel!! anders is het x keer dezelfde tegel maar met alleen een andere naam:)

Cdt

2 likes

Hallo

Bedankt voor je eerste antwoorden en hier zijn enkele schermafbeeldingen bijgevoegd. In plaats van te beginnen met het echte probleem, stelde ik me een zeshoekig oppervlak en tegels voor om het te bedekken en daarom moesten er sneden worden gemaakt aan de randen van de zeshoek, om oplossingen te vinden met een eenvoudig geval dat kan worden toegepast op complexere situaties. Dus afbeelding "Test_3", vertegenwoordigt mijn zeshoekige oppervlak (zeshoek van 1000 plat) met een tegelbedekking van 300 mm op een afstand van 4 mm uit elkaar. Ik wilde ook de tabel van de kamerfamilie sturen, maar het lijkt erop dat je maar één bestand tegelijk kunt verzenden, dus ik doe het met een ander antwoord...


test_3.jpg

.... Vervolg, bijgevoegd is mijn tafel (famille_pièce) met de familie van tegels die veel verschillende namen hebben

Hartelijk dank


famille_piece.jpg

G

Ik begreep je opmerking niet echt, want net als in mijn vorige toevoeging met de familie van onderdelen, heb ik wel een andere naam en in mijn montage na de herhaling op het oppervlak heb ik elke randtegel hernoemd voordat ik de aanpassingen aan de randen maakte, maar het werkt niet. Komt dit overeen met uw opmerking of is  het iets anders?

Hartelijk dank

Hallo

op basis van uw "Test 3.jpg"-bestand

Als elk van uw tegels een andere configuratie is, als u in uw assemblage bent, als u met de rechtermuisknop op een tegel klikt, heeft u bovenaan de optie om uw configuratie te kiezen, controleer of ze allemaal een andere configuratie hebben. Er is veel symmetrie, dus om tijd te besparen, door een volledig symmetrisch stuk te maken. Werk op 1/4 van uw oppervlak, dan maakt u een perfecte symmetrie van uw onderdelen en creëert u tegelijkertijd automatisch een configuratie. (door de pijlen in de gespiegelde functie te scrollen).

Als ik me niet vergis, kun je 6 verschillende tegels bedenken.

Maar dat is een detail...

Werk in uw assemblage om uw tegels aan te passen aan uw zeshoekige snede door met de rechtermuisknop te klikken/het stuk te bewerken. U kunt direct in uw kamer aan de configuratie van het bestand werken en daarom uw tegel snijden volgens de lijnen van uw zeshoekige. Ik doe dit voor je op SW 2014 en stuur je dit als voorbeeld.

 


test_carreau.zip
1 like

Hallo

op basis van uw "Test 3.jpg"-bestand

Als elk van uw tegels een andere configuratie is, als u in uw assemblage bent, als u met de rechtermuisknop op een tegel klikt, heeft u bovenaan de optie om uw configuratie te kiezen, controleer of ze allemaal een andere configuratie hebben. Er is veel symmetrie, dus om tijd te besparen, door een volledig symmetrisch stuk te maken. Werk op 1/4 van uw oppervlak, dan maakt u een perfecte symmetrie van uw onderdelen en creëert u tegelijkertijd automatisch een configuratie. (door de pijlen in de gespiegelde functie te scrollen).

Als ik me niet vergis, kun je 6 verschillende tegels bedenken.

Maar dat is een detail...

Werk in uw assemblage om uw tegels aan te passen aan uw zeshoekige snede door met de rechtermuisknop te klikken/het stuk te bewerken. U kunt direct in uw kamer aan de configuratie van het bestand werken en daarom uw tegel snijden volgens de lijnen van uw zeshoekige. Ik doe dit voor je op SW 2014 en stuur je dit als voorbeeld.

 


test_carreau.zip
1 like

Hallo

Persoonlijk zou ik door een plaatwerkonderdeelvijl zijn gegaan, een extrusie door de verwijderingsrichting te veranderen  en het is voorbij.

Hallo Yves, Fab,

Allereerst bedankt voor uw ideeën en advies. Fantastisch, ik heb je gegevens zonder problemen geopend en ik begrijp niet alle manipulaties die er op het tegelbestand zijn, vooral de regels die grijs zijn, kun je me misschien wat aanvullende informatie geven? Heb je een familie van toneelstukken gemaakt die hier niet voorkomt?

Gisteravond na mijn bericht, bleef ik nadenken en vond ik een mogelijke oplossing, maar het lijkt me niet erg elegant, maar het werkt ongeacht het oppervlak (omdat ik in mijn test een eenvoudig oppervlak had genomen). Ik heb het in mijn bericht gezet en bedankt als je me kunt vertellen wat je ervan vindt. In feite mijn aanpak: ik neem een tegel en in de montage bedek ik het hele te betegelen oppervlak met symmetrie, dan teken ik een schets op de omtrek van het te betegelen oppervlak en vervolgens gebruik ik de functie "offset-entiteiten" om alle tegels te bedekken die van het oppervlak zijn; Ten slotte gebruik ik de functie "Geëxtrudeerd materiaal verwijderen" om onnodige stukken tegel te verwijderen. Het werkt heel goed omdat ik heb getest met "linkse" oppervlakken, maar mijn eerste idee was om de afmetingen van de gesneden tegels te herstellen en daar weet ik niet hoe ik het moet doen en ik weet niet of het mogelijk is!

Fab in het bijgevoegde bestand mijn ingebeelde oplossing (SLW 14) en een afbeelding van de boom van creatie van uw tegel met in grijs de informatie die ik niet begrijp.

Om volledig te zijn, bedankt Yves voor je info, maar voor mij is het misschien wat ingewikkelder omdat ik de plaatwerkfuncties niet al te veel beheers, maar ik zal er naar kijken.

Met vriendelijke groet, en nogmaals bedankt aan iedereen

Wanneer 2 mensen een idee uitwisselen, zijn het niet twee maar minstens 3 ideeën (Idriss Aberkan)


test_carreleur.zip
2 likes

Hallo, wat ik eigenlijk wilde zeggen, is dat alleen omdat we een onderdeel hernoemen, dit niet noodzakelijkerwijs betekent dat Solidworks ze onderscheidt. dit komt omdat Solidworks kijkt naar de bron en paden van de bestanden en niet naar hun namen.

Je oplossing is tenslotte niet slecht, maar zoals je al zei, heb je niet de afmetingen van je uitsparingen. Je maakt verschillende tegels, je voegt ze in je assemblage in (met vrije schetsen), dan beperk je je schetsen in het geheel (externe verwijzingen naar de onderdelen) en dan heb je ernaast alleen je onderdelen die de juiste afmetingen zullen hebben.

Cdt

1 like

Hoi Midou, 

het bestand met de testoppervlak ontbreekt in uw zip-bestand.

Als ik een "testtegel" open, zijn ze allemaal gelijk 300x300 op al je configuraties.

Het verwijderen van materiaal dat u in de assemblage hebt gedaan, betreft ALLEEN de montage, met andere woorden, het is een eenvoudige manier om snel een assemblage bij te werken, maar in uw geval wijzigt het het "tegel"-onderdeelbestand niet.

Om dit te doen, moet u het vakje "de functie doorgeven aan onderdelen" onderaan in uw materiaalverwijderingsfunctie aanvinken.

Nu om mijn manip uit te leggen en ook de grijze lijnen.

De grijze lijnen zijn gewoon actieve of niet-actieve functies, afhankelijk van de configuratie.

Wanneer u naar de configuratiemanager van de kamer gaat en u de ene configuratie selecteert en vervolgens de andere, zult u merken dat de lijnen grijs worden weergegeven of nuchter zijn. 

Om de methode uit te leggen, heb ik een tegel van 300x300 gemaakt die ik in de assemblage heb geplaatst met een verschoven van 2 mm (de helft van de voeg) vanaf het voor- en rechtervlak.

Vervolgens heb ik een lokale lineaire 1 herhaling gemaakt van deze tegel in de richting van de X en vervolgens een één in  y van deze 2 tegels.

Voor andere cirkelvormige symmetrieën en herhalingen, klik op de objecten om te zien hoe ze op elkaar inwerken.

Daarna werkte ik in de assemblage, ik maakte verschillende configuraties.

Wanneer u in de assemblage met de rechtermuisknop op een tegel klikt, kunt u de configuratie van deze tegel wijzigen.

Wanneer u dit onderdeel in de assembly bewerkt, hebben de wijzigingen alleen betrekking op deze configuratie (daarom worden functies grijs weergegeven op basis van de configuratie)

Ik heb geen familie van onderdelen gemaakt, maar niets belet je om er daarna een toe te voegen met "invoeging/tabel/familie van stukken". Het zal de bestaande configuraties gebruiken om zijn onderdelenfamilielijst te maken.

1 like

Hoi Midou, 

het bestand met de testoppervlak ontbreekt in uw zip-bestand.

Als ik een "testtegel" open, zijn ze allemaal gelijk 300x300 op al je configuraties.

Het verwijderen van materiaal dat u in de assemblage hebt gedaan, betreft ALLEEN de montage, met andere woorden, het is een eenvoudige manier om snel een assemblage bij te werken, maar in uw geval wijzigt het het "tegel"-onderdeelbestand niet.

Om dit te doen, moet u het vakje "de functie doorgeven aan onderdelen" onderaan in uw materiaalverwijderingsfunctie aanvinken.

Nu om mijn manip uit te leggen en ook de grijze lijnen.

De grijze lijnen zijn gewoon actieve of niet-actieve functies, afhankelijk van de configuratie.

Wanneer u naar de configuratiemanager van de kamer gaat en u de ene configuratie selecteert en vervolgens de andere, zult u merken dat de lijnen grijs worden weergegeven of nuchter zijn. 

Om de methode uit te leggen, heb ik een tegel van 300x300 gemaakt die ik in de assemblage heb geplaatst met een verschoven van 2 mm (de helft van de voeg) vanaf het voor- en rechtervlak.

Vervolgens heb ik een lokale lineaire 1 herhaling gemaakt van deze tegel in de richting van de X en vervolgens een één in  y van deze 2 tegels.

Voor andere cirkelvormige symmetrieën en herhalingen, klik op de objecten om te zien hoe ze op elkaar inwerken.

Daarna werkte ik in de assemblage, ik maakte verschillende configuraties.

Wanneer u in de assemblage met de rechtermuisknop op een tegel klikt, kunt u de configuratie van deze tegel wijzigen.

Wanneer u dit onderdeel in de assembly bewerkt, hebben de wijzigingen alleen betrekking op deze configuratie (daarom worden functies grijs weergegeven op basis van de configuratie)

Ik heb geen familie van onderdelen gemaakt, maar niets belet je om er daarna een toe te voegen met "invoeging/tabel/familie van stukken". Het zal de bestaande configuraties gebruiken om zijn onderdelenfamilielijst te maken.

1 like

Hoi Fab,

Ik heb geprobeerd uw advies ("de functie doorgeven aan onderdelen") toe te passen in de materiaalverwijderingsfunctie, maar het genereert veel fouten die ik moeilijk kan identificeren. Is dit te wijten aan mijn aanvankelijke beperkingen die niet correct zijn voor het gebruik van deze optie????

Ik stuur je een map met alle bestanden, ter info.

Bedankt

Vriendelijke groeten


test_carreleur_2.rar

Hoi Midou, ik heb naar je dossier gekeken, altijd moeilijk uit te leggen, dus ik zal beginnen met je bestanden om te proberen duidelijker te zijn.

het is heel normaal dat je rood wordt nadat je je functie hebt gecreëerd door je voort te planten naar de onderdelen, het rood begint vanuit een afstandsbeperking omdat je vraagt om een verwijdering van materiaal door te verwijzen naar een rand die uiteindelijk na deze extrusie niet meer bestaat, SW erin verdwaalt en het in het rood noemt.

Aan de andere kant vraag je ook om een verwijdering van materiaal in je onderdelen MAAR je hebt veel onderdelen die je met dezelfde configuratie achterlaat ... Dus op een configuratie van een foutonderdeel bijvoorbeeld, je extrudeert een stuk aan de linkerkant van de tegel en op een andere tegel, maar die dezelfde configuratie heeft, vertel je het om deze keer een rechteruiteinde te verwijderen ... SW gaat weer eens verloren.

Om uw probleem op te lossen:

klik met de rechtermuisknop op elke tegel in de 3D en wijzig de configuratie door te valideren met het groene vinkje.

Verwijder dan uw afstandsbeperking 1. Ter informatie: het verdient in dit geval de voorkeur om u te baseren op een bestaand plan; in uw geval heb ik uw testoppervlak verplaatst zodat de plannen van dit onderdeel overeenkomen met die van de montage. Van daaruit heb ik de centrale tegel N 6 tot 2 mm van het voorste vlak van de assemblage beperkt. Eindig met je extrusie door door de onderdelen te propageren. En daar werkt het. Dit blijft ingewikkeld voor wat er te doen is, maar er is geen regel, dan leer je na verloop van tijd tijd te besparen door de manier om solidworks te gebruiken te vereenvoudigen.

Yves zou het bijvoorbeeld op een andere manier hebben gedaan.


test_carreleur_bon.zip
1 like

Hoi Fab,

Bedankt voor al je inspanningen die me ertoe hebben gebracht dingen beter te begrijpen, in feite is er nog maar één laatste vraag die ik mezelf stel, namelijk of we de afmetingen van de gesneden tegels in het bestand met de familie van stukken direct kunnen herstellen, maar ik heb de indruk dat dit niet het geval is. In feite heb ik in mijn testvoorbeeld een oplossing gevonden die bestaat uit het direct dimensioneren van de gesneden tegels en aangezien er nogal wat overeenkomsten zijn (in dit voorbeeld, zie bijgevoegde afbeelding) is het vrij eenvoudig. Nu moet ik het aanbrengen op mijn echte oppervlak dat iets complexer is (echt geval van een kameroppervlak dat moet worden betegeld).

In ieder geval, zoals u zegt, zijn er verschillende mogelijke oplossingen (zoals de oplossing van Yves) en ik dank alle deelnemers die antwoorden op mijn probleem hebben gegeven en aangezien er oplossingen zijn voor de gestelde vraag, denk ik dat ik de vraag zal sluiten, vooral omdat ik een verzoek van de site heb ontvangen.

Dus nogmaals bedankt en tot ziens op andere onderwerpen (zoals: kunnen we de gewijzigde afmetingen van een familie van onderdelen herstellen???)

Met vriendelijke groet

Meester


carrelage_pose_dimensions.jpg